Although it seems the clouds are settling over the matter with Napoli FC deleting the posts and offering some explanations on the controversial post, Okocha rose in defense of Osimhen advising him to weigh his options. “Osimhen should know what is best for him, whether to continue in Napoli or elsewhere seek a new challenge. I don’t think he should narrow his decision to a Tik Tok post,” he said.
